As animals grow larger, staying cool while travelling over long distances becomes more and more difficult – and this seems to be what limits their speed

The issue is that muscles are fundamentally very inefficient, says Dyer. “For every 100 joules of chemical energy that gets pumped into your muscles, 70 of those joules are just turned into heat.”
